Competitor eligibility:

a. The USRowing Youth National Championship is an invitational championship regatta.

b. A junior is a competitor who in the current calendar year does not attain the age of 19, or who is and has been continuously enrolled in secondary school as a full-time student seeking a diploma. For the purposes of eligibility for the USRowing Youth National Championships this definition will include post graduate athletes who meet the criteria stated above.

c. Affiliation with only one program, which he/she is registered with as of the first competition (registered/ non-registered, not including indoor events) for the duration of the spring season, defined between January 1 and June 15 of that current calendar year, to participate in the USRowing Youth National Championship Regatta. 

Crews must qualify for a Youth National Championship bid by attending a recognized qualification regatta and placing in one of the 16 Youth National Championship events.
